New Model: Ferretti Custom Line 28 Navetta

Ferretti presents its latest Custom Line model with the new 28 Navetta. Unlike the previous Navetta, designer Zuccon took a more explorer yacht look in the new 28, this enhanced by a rising shear-line which sets the bow looking higher, and the raised deck on top.  Launched in Cannes 2014, the 28 Navetta main selling feature is its innovative stern dual mode transom; this offering a wet dock launch system and space for a four meters plus tender, and the expansion of the bathing platform into a beach area which measures fifteen square meters.  Inside the 28 Navetta offers a four double guest rooms below deck, and an owners stateroom on the main floor forward. Crew space is for six persons in three cabins located in the bow tip below deck.  Ferretti also offers an additional layout for the main deck with an option of an astern bar serving the aft cockpit, taking space from the lounging sofa.
Technical Data:
LOA - 28.31 m (92.9ft)
Hull Length - 23.9 m
Waterline Length - 23.8 m
Beam - 7 m
Draft - 2.21 m
Displacement - 89500 kg unladen, 106000 kg loaded
Fuel Capacity - 12400 l
Water Capacity - 2000 l
Accommodation - 10 guests in 5 cabins, 6 crew in 3 cabins
Max Persons - 20
Engines - 2 x Man 1200hp
Propulsion - line shaft 
Speed - 16 knots max, 13 knots cruise
Range - 640 nm at 13 knots
Project - Zuccon Internation lines and interior, Ferretti AYT Engineering
